Transaction 58824e66f19cf8d6ddbe666a73145554e41d2eb0d4d99b0f52cb189e2530692e
1 Input
1 Output
-
58824e66f19cf8d6ddbe666a73145554e41d2eb0d4d99b0f52cb189e2530692e:0
- value
- 87686
- script pubkey
- OP_0 OP_PUSHBYTES_32 3aedb3b7ace7c2618790ff86d5def377a0e75e92b64e16c7e5cedbdb90d87cb9
- address
- bc1q8tkm8davulpxrpusl7rdthhnw7swwh5jke8pd3l9emdahyxc0jushh7zpy